The healthcare facility in question has garnered overwhelmingly negative feedback from patients regarding its night shift nursing staff. Many patients have expressed their experiences, describing the majority of nurses during this time as not only unhelpful but also outright angry and rude. The frustration is palpable, with several individuals noting that while some daytime staff exhibit a slightly better attitude, the overall experience falls drastically short of acceptable standards. Amid these challenges, two male nurses stationed during the day stand out as exemplary figures—acknowledged by patients as crucial to their well-being. Their dedicated care has been a beacon of hope amidst an otherwise dismal atmosphere.
Beyond the troubling demeanor of some nurses, patients have highlighted serious concerns about basic hospitality and service standards within the facility. A particularly glaring issue is the temperature of served meals; reports indicate that hot meals are frequently delivered stone cold. This lack of attention to such fundamental aspects certainly exacerbates the already distressed state of patients who require nourishment for recovery. Furthermore, concerns extend beyond merely cold food; they encompass broader issues related to hygiene and cleanliness throughout the establishment—a standard described as being unfit even for an animal shelter. Such conditions raise alarm bells regarding patient health and safety.
In terms of medical care delivery, there are significant deficiencies noted in response times for medication administration and wound management. Patients have recounted instances where they waited excruciatingly long hours for necessary pain relief medications—an experience that becomes intolerable when faced with pressing medical needs following surgery or hospitalization. Rather than being proactive in checking on patients’ needs—such as changing dressings after surgical procedures—the staff appears unengaged and often requires reminders from the patients themselves to address these critical tasks.
A distressing observation made by multiple reviewers is the alarming prevalence of inattentiveness among some nursing staff members, who seem more preoccupied with their phones than attending to urgent patient needs. Reports indicate that multiple buzzers signal requests for help while nurses remain absorbed in texting or playing games on their devices rather than assisting those in need. For vulnerable individuals requiring immediate attention—especially those dealing with challenges like incontinence—the impact can be both physically uncomfortable and emotionally distressing.
Patient reviews consistently depict a frightening reality: incontinent individuals may wait agonizingly long periods before receiving assistance, leading to indignity and discomfort caused by sitting in wet clothing or bedding for extensive durations—a scenario no one should ever face within a healthcare setting designed to provide support and care during times of vulnerability. These accounts point toward a systemic failure within staffing practices and operational protocols that prioritize efficiency over basic human dignity.
